This article applies to Microsoft Dynamics NAV 2009 for the Spanish (es) language locale.

Symptoms

When you generate a file from the "Make 340 Declaration" report in the Spanish version of Microsoft Dynamics NAV, position 77 and position 78 show the country code of a customer. However, position 77 and position 78 should show the EU country code of a customer. Additionally, position 79 and position 80 should show the country code of a customer.

This problem occurs in the following products:

  • The Spanish version of Microsoft Dynamics NAV 2009 Service Pack 1

  • The Spanish version of Microsoft Dynamics NAV 2009

  • The Spanish version of Microsoft Dynamics NAV 5.0 Service Pack 1

  • The Spanish version of Microsoft Dynamics NAV 5.0

Note Before you install this hotfix, verify that all Microsoft Navision client users are logged off the system. This includes Microsoft Navision Application Services (NAS) client users. You should be the only client user who is logged on when you implement this hotfix.

To implement this hotfix, you must have a developer license.

We recommend that the user account in the Windows Logins window or in the Database Logins window be assigned the "SUPER" role ID. If the user account cannot be assigned the "SUPER" role ID, you must verify that the user account has the following permissions:

  • The Modify permission for the object that you will be changing.

  • The Execute permission for the System Object ID 5210 object and for the System Object ID 9015 object.



Note You do not have to have rights to the data stores unless you have to perform data repair.

Code changes

Note Always test code fixes in a controlled environment before you apply the fixes to your production computers.
To resolve this problem, follow these steps:

  1. Change the code in the RecordTypeSale function in the "Make 340 Declaration" report (10743) as follows:
    Existing code

    ...
    ELSE
    CustVATNumber := '';
    IF FindEUCountryRegionCode(Customer."Country/Region Code") <> '' THEN
    CountryCode := FindEUCountryRegionCode(Customer."Country/Region Code")
    ELSE
    CountryCode := Customer."Country/Region Code";
    IF Customer."Country/Region Code" = CompanyInfo."Country/Region Code" THEN
    ResidentIDText := '1'
    ...

    Replacement code

    ...
    ELSE
    CustVATNumber := '';
    CountryCode := Customer."Country/Region Code";
    IF Customer."Country/Region Code" = CompanyInfo."Country/Region Code" THEN
    ResidentIDText := '1'
    ...
  2. Change the code in the RecordTypePurchase function in the "Make 340 Declaration" report (10743) as follows:
    Existing code

    ...
    ELSE
    VendVATNumber := '';
    IF FindEUCountryRegionCode(Vendor."Country/Region Code") <> '' THEN
    CountryCode := FindEUCountryRegionCode(Vendor."Country/Region Code")
    ELSE
    CountryCode := PADSTR(Vendor."Country/Region Code",2,' ');
    IF Vendor."Country/Region Code" <> CompanyInfo."Country/Region Code" THEN BEGIN
    IF FindEUCountryRegionCode(Vendor."Country/Region Code") <> '' THEN
    ...

    Replacement code

    ...
    ELSE
    VendVATNumber := '';
    CountryCode := PADSTR(Vendor."Country/Region Code",2,' ');
    IF Vendor."Country/Region Code" <> CompanyInfo."Country/Region Code" THEN BEGIN
    IF FindEUCountryRegionCode(Vendor."Country/Region Code") <> '' THEN
    ...
